6 herramientas gratuitas de documentación de API

Noticias

HogarHogar / Noticias / 6 herramientas gratuitas de documentación de API

Jul 05, 2023

6 herramientas gratuitas de documentación de API

Ayude a sus clientes de API a obtener lo mejor de su servicio con servicios de primer nivel

Ayude a sus clientes de API a obtener lo mejor de su servicio con documentación de primer nivel.

Al desarrollar una API, necesita herramientas para documentar sus características y funcionalidad. La documentación ayuda a los usuarios a descubrir cómo integrar y utilizar la API.

Una búsqueda rápida en Google muestra que hay muchas herramientas de documentación disponibles en línea. Elegir la herramienta adecuada para optimizar su flujo de trabajo y producir contenido útil puede ser desalentador. Las herramientas gratuitas de documentación de API que presentamos aquí lo ayudarán a aprovechar al máximo sus API.

SwaggerHub ocupa el primer lugar en la lista de las mejores herramientas de documentación en línea. Con su conjunto de herramientas de código abierto, simplifica significativamente el desarrollo de API.

Las herramientas de SwaggerHub ayudan a diseñar API dentro de OAS, la especificación OpenAPI. Puede utilizar el inspector de Swagger para evaluar su API con respecto a los estándares de la OEA.

También puede mantener un repositorio central con sus equipos utilizando las especificaciones de la OEA. Con Swagger, puede diseñar, desarrollar y documentar API en una plataforma. Su conjunto de aplicaciones se adapta a todas las partes del ciclo de vida de la API y le permite escalar a voluntad.

La plataforma colaborativa de Swagger admite pruebas, virtualización, simulación y monitoreo de API. Con el editor de Swagger y la interfaz de usuario, puede visualizar el desarrollo de API y crear documentación completa simultáneamente.

Para comenzar con Swagger, diríjase al sitio web, cree una cuenta gratuita y use su completo conjunto de herramientas.

Postman es una herramienta popular para probar y documentar API. Puede organizar las solicitudes de API en archivos y carpetas lógicos, lo que facilita que los usuarios encuentren lo que buscan.

Postman tiene tutoriales, guías de inicio y guías de solución de problemas que ayudan a los usuarios a usarlo. Su estructura tiene secciones claramente etiquetadas que muestran a los usuarios dónde y cómo usar sus herramientas.

Una de las mejores características de Postman es su capacidad para realizar pruebas exhaustivas de API. Almacena las credenciales del cliente en un archivo de entorno. Cuando un usuario envía una solicitud, completa los encabezados y parámetros de la solicitud. Por lo tanto, no tiene que escribir los detalles de la API cada vez que la prueba.

Su interfaz multifacética admite la colaboración con sus equipos. También puede bifurcar código de hosts de repositorio como GitHub o GitLab.

Además, Postman ayuda a autenticar las API generando tokens y claves de acceso. Con estas herramientas eficientes, puede crear y administrar sus API de manera efectiva.

Puede descargar la versión de escritorio de Postman de forma gratuita o utilizar su cliente HTTP en la web. Elija lo que funcione mejor para usted.

Document360 es una ventanilla única para la documentación API completa. El sitio web tiene funciones interactivas que facilitan la comprensión y el uso de las API.

Su interfaz admite pruebas de API utilizando múltiples definiciones y versiones de API. También puede usar el editor de texto adjunto para crear documentación personalizada para sus API. Su búsqueda impulsada por IA ayuda a encontrar lo que necesita rápidamente.

La documentación de la API está en el centro de Document360. La plataforma ayuda a administrar las características y la documentación de la API en la misma plataforma. Puede agregar páginas a los documentos, tutoriales y otras características que no forman parte del archivo de definición de la API.

Puede generar ejemplos de código para llamadas API y usarlos en su aplicación. También puede agregar muestras de código, lo que permite a los usuarios comprender el contenido de la programación.

Document360 tiene varias herramientas de colaboración que permiten a los equipos trabajar juntos en el desarrollo de API. Puede registrarse para obtener una cuenta gratuita con acceso limitado o optar por cuentas pagas con funciones avanzadas.

El sitio web de Redocly adopta el enfoque doc-as-code. Aquí, puede integrar herramientas de codificación con documentación. La capacidad de integración permite a los desarrolladores integrar el proceso de desarrollo con la documentación. Los usuarios pueden convertir rápidamente su material de referencia de API en documentación en un portal.

Puede usar editores de código como VS Code para escribir documentación junto con el código. Además, puede vincular su espacio de trabajo a Git para almacenar y realizar un seguimiento de los cambios en sus materiales.

Redocly es ideal para desarrolladores que buscan plataformas que integren documentos y código. El espacio de trabajo integrado admite el desarrollo y las pruebas de las API antes de la producción.

Los desarrolladores experimentados con React pueden manipular sus componentes para adaptarse a varios casos de uso. Es extensible.

También admite colaboraciones en equipo, lo que permite a los usuarios trabajar en proyectos similares simultáneamente. Redocly tiene cuentas gratuitas y de pago para acceder a su kit de herramientas avanzado.

Stoplight se destaca de otras plataformas de documentación con soporte para las mejores prácticas de diseño de API. Su interfaz colaborativa equipa a los equipos con herramientas integrales para crear API de calidad.

Puede diseñar, desarrollar y administrar API, todo en la misma plataforma. Stoplight utiliza un enfoque de diseño primero que lo guía para estructurar sus API. Tienen una guía de estilo en forma de plantilla que guía su proceso de diseño y definiciones de API.

También puede usar la guía como una guía de gobierno para su equipo durante todo el proceso de diseño. Las mejores prácticas de Stoplight agregan valor al diseño de API y promueven un desarrollo rápido. Impulsa los estándares y el control de calidad para su equipo.

La documentación de Stoplight lo ayuda a entregar contenido de calidad para su API. Admite documentación de referencia de API con definiciones de características de API y ejemplos de código.

También puede crear guías de inicio rápido y tutoriales interactivos. Incluso puede agregar imágenes y guías de solución de problemas a su contenido. Stoplight tiene planes gratuitos y pagos para usted y su equipo.

De todas las herramientas de esta lista, ReadMe es la única que analiza el rendimiento de la API. La plataforma tiene métricas que analizan el uso de la API y la resolución de problemas para mejorar la calidad.

Puede monitorear el rendimiento de la API por la cantidad de solicitudes exitosas frente a las fallidas. Si nota un problema con una solicitud en particular, puede priorizar su resolución.

También puede ver vistas de página, usuarios, términos de búsqueda populares y calificaciones de página a través de API Explorer. Los usuarios pueden dejar comentarios sobre su experiencia para ayudarte a mejorar.

La información ayuda a reducir el público objetivo y determinar los servicios más populares. Esto puede ayudarlo a modificar el diseño de su API para descubrir nuevos negocios.

Stoplight admite el diseño de API basado en las especificaciones de OpenAPI. Esto garantiza que sus API sean de buena calidad. También puede integrar GitHub para almacenar y rastrear su código y Swagger para ver y probar sus API.

Puede crear productos personalizados, guías empresariales y API con Léame. Registrarse y utilizarlo es totalmente gratuito.

Ahora que conoce algunas de las mejores herramientas de documentación de API en línea, es hora de elegir. Elegir la herramienta de documentación de API adecuada es esencial para su flujo de trabajo.

Debe elegir una herramienta de documentación que admita la redacción de artículos, métricas y filtrado. Debe tener funciones de estilo integradas para crear y dar formato a la documentación.

También debe integrar software de apoyo como control de versiones y muestras de código. Elija una herramienta de documentación con estas características adecuada para el software y su equipo.

Sandra es una entusiasta de la tecnología con una amplia experiencia en periodismo y desarrollo web completo. Se especializa en desarrollo web y tecnología Cloud. Para el ocio, Sandra disfruta de un buen thriller, la lectura y el senderismo por la montaña.

MAKEUSEOF VÍDEO DEL DÍA DESPLAZARSE PARA CONTINUAR CON EL CONTENIDO